Deniz Defne Acerol

 

Born in Hong Kong in 1990, Deniz graduated from Mimar Sinan Fine Arts University, Painting Department, in 2013. In the same year, she opened her first solo exhibition and has since participated in numerous fairs and exhibitions.

She has been working with her collectors on various designs for some time. In addition to being a painter, she has also created graphic designs in different fields such as posters, album covers, wine labels, scarves, and wallpapers. She continues her work in her studio in Istanbul.

Deniz, who loves to tell stories and create imaginary spaces, approaches the present day with mythological imagery, drawing references from art history. She processes her imaginary scenes with a rich narrative language using methods she discovered after extensive technical research. She prefers to work with water-based materials, which are best suited to her detail-oriented character.

Influenced by her birth in Hong Kong, Deniz has a patterned and ethereal painting style characteristic of Far Eastern art. Starting from the etching technique, she has brought a drawing method called hatching, used by old masters, into the present day. By combining this method with watercolor, she produces illustrative paintings with an intensive technical background.
